Hello everyone,

I have been making a block with a custom model and have run into a problem.

Surrounding blocks become see-throu like an x-ray effect.

I have read a forum post that this might be caused by wrongly set Opacity, but the method which is supposed to be overwritten no longer exists.

Thank you in advance.

Make Block#isOpaqueCube return false.

1 minute ago, SaltStation said:

1.12

Use your IDE to find the correct parameters Block#isOpaqueCube exists in 1.12 and it has an IBlockState parameter.

Just now, SaltStation said:

Should I be worried about it being Depricated though?

No, Minecraft is really weird about what it uses deprecation for. When they use it for blocks it means don't call it.
